FAQ

What is the Gerald Bergquist Scholarship?
The Gerald Bergquist Scholarship is offered by the Community Foundation for Southwest Washington to support students from R.A. Long High School in covering educational costs.
How can I make my essay stand out?
To make your essay stand out, focus on unique personal experiences, specific achievements, and clear reflections on how the scholarship will help you achieve your goals.
What should I include in the introduction?
Start your essay with a concrete moment or experience that captures your journey. This will engage the reader and set the tone for the rest of your essay.
